    Automotive Cast Iron Cylinder Head Market Summary

    The Global Automotive Cast Iron Cylinder Head Market is projected to grow from 28.8 USD Billion in 2024 to 34.0 USD Billion by 2035.

    Key Market Trends & Highlights

    Automotive Cast Iron Cylinder Head Key Trends and Highlights

    • The market is expected to experience a compound annual growth rate (CAGR) of 1.52% from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 34.0 USD Billion, reflecting steady growth.
    • In 2024, the market is valued at 28.8 USD Billion, indicating a robust starting point for future expansion.
    • Growing adoption of advanced manufacturing techniques due to increasing demand for fuel efficiency is a major market driver.

    Market Size & Forecast

    2024 Market Size 28.8 (USD Billion)
    2035 Market Size 34.0 (USD Billion)
    CAGR (2025-2035) 1.52%

    Market Segment Insights

    Automotive Cast Iron Cylinder Head Market Type Insights

    The Automotive Cast Iron Cylinder Head Market, specifically focusing on Type, showcases a diverse range of configurations with distinct market values and significance. The overall market is poised to reach approximately 27.94 USD Billion in 2023, underpinning the demand for cast iron cylinder heads in the automotive industry.

    Within this segment, the valuation reveals varying degrees of market presence for different types, with the Four Valve configuration notably dominating the landscape at 10.0 USD Billion in 2023, projected to increase to 12.0 USD Billion in 2032.This configuration's popularity can be attributed to its enhanced performance and efficiency characteristics, making it a preferred choice among manufacturers aiming for higher power output and better fuel efficiency. Following this, the Two Valve configuration represents a significant share of the market, valued at 5.0 USD Billion in 2023 and expected to grow to 6.0 USD Billion by 2032.

    Two Valve designs are often simpler and more cost-effective, appealing to manufacturers focused on budget-friendly models. The Five Valve configuration, valued at 4.5 USD Billion in 2023, exemplifies a balance between performance and complexity, anticipated to reach 5.5 USD Billion by 2032.This type benefits from a design that optimizes airflow and combustion efficiency, which is increasingly sought after in contemporary automotive applications.

    The V-type designs, representing 3.0 USD Billion in 2023, are popular in high-performance vehicles, and their projected increase to 3.5 USD Billion in 2032 highlights their niche presence driven by sports and luxury car manufacturers seeking compact and powerful engines.

    Lastly, the Inline configuration, valued at 5.44 USD Billion in 2023, though slightly declining to 5.0 USD Billion by 2032, still represents a traditional choice for many vehicle models, primarily due to its straightforward manufacturing process and reliability in diverse vehicle types.This segmentation reveals how varying designs cater to specific automotive needs and preferences, reflecting broader trends in engine development and consumer demand. The Automotive Cast Iron Cylinder Head Market data underscores the importance of understanding these dynamics for stakeholders aiming to navigate market opportunities effectively.

    Regional Insights

    The Automotive Cast Iron Cylinder Head Market is experiencing notable growth across various regional segments, with overall revenues projected at 27.94 USD Billion in 2023. North America remains a dominant player in the market, valued at 10.5 USD Billion, representing a significant portion of the market share. The region's advanced automotive industry and robust demand for high-performance engines contribute to its majority holding.

    Europe follows closely, accounting for 8.0 USD Billion, driven by stringent emissions regulations and increasing automotive production.The APAC region, valued at 6.0 USD Billion, is also essential as it supports a rapidly growing automotive sector, emphasizing cost-effective manufacturing and high-volume production. Meanwhile, South America and MEA represent smaller market shares, valued at 2.5 USD Billion and 1.94 USD Billion, respectively, both showcasing emerging opportunities amid rising automotive demands. The overall Automotive Cast Iron Cylinder Head Market data reflects a gradual growth trend driven by emerging markets and technological advancements, with opportunities for expansion across all regions, albeit at varying rates.
